AI助手开发中如何优化错误恢复机制?
在人工智能助手领域,错误恢复机制是保证服务质量的关键因素之一。一个优秀的AI助手,不仅需要具备强大的学习能力,更需要具备出色的错误恢复能力。本文将讲述一位AI助手开发者如何通过不断优化错误恢复机制,最终打造出一款深受用户喜爱的智能助手的故事。
李明是一名年轻的AI助手开发者,他从小就对人工智能充满兴趣。大学毕业后,他毅然决然地投身于这个充满挑战和机遇的领域。经过几年的努力,他终于开发出了一款名为“小智”的AI助手。然而,在实际应用过程中,小智的表现并不尽如人意,错误频发,让李明倍感苦恼。
一天,小智在处理一个用户咨询时,由于数据库中没有相关记录,导致回复错误。用户对此非常不满,甚至要求退款。这使李明意识到,必须优化小智的错误恢复机制,否则将影响产品的口碑和用户满意度。
为了解决这个问题,李明开始深入研究AI助手错误恢复的相关知识。他阅读了大量文献,参加了多次行业研讨会,与同行们交流心得。在这个过程中,他逐渐总结出以下几点优化策略:
- 提高错误识别能力
首先,小智需要具备强大的错误识别能力。为此,李明对现有的错误处理机制进行了改进。他引入了多种错误识别算法,如基于规则、基于模式匹配和基于机器学习等方法。通过这些算法,小智能够快速识别出错误类型,为后续处理提供依据。
- 优化错误处理流程
在错误处理流程方面,李明对原有流程进行了优化。他设计了以下几个步骤:
(1)错误识别:当小智检测到错误时,立即启动错误处理流程。
(2)错误分类:根据错误类型,将错误分为不同类别,如系统错误、数据错误、语法错误等。
(3)错误处理:针对不同类别的错误,采取相应的处理措施。例如,对于系统错误,可以尝试重启系统;对于数据错误,可以尝试修正数据;对于语法错误,可以尝试修正语法。
(4)错误反馈:将错误处理结果反馈给用户,提高用户体验。
- 强化错误恢复能力
为了提高小智的错误恢复能力,李明在以下几个方面进行了优化:
(1)引入容错机制:在系统设计时,考虑容错性,使系统在出现错误时能够继续运行。
(2)优化算法:针对不同类型的错误,优化算法,提高错误恢复成功率。
(3)加强数据备份:定期备份系统数据,确保在出现数据错误时,能够快速恢复。
- 提升用户体验
在优化错误恢复机制的过程中,李明始终关注用户体验。他通过以下措施提升用户体验:
(1)简化操作流程:简化错误处理流程,让用户能够轻松解决问题。
(2)提供帮助信息:在错误处理过程中,为用户提供详细的帮助信息,帮助用户解决问题。
(3)及时反馈:在错误处理过程中,及时向用户反馈处理结果,让用户了解问题解决进度。
经过一段时间的努力,小智的错误恢复能力得到了显著提升。在实际应用中,小智的表现也越来越稳定,赢得了用户的认可。然而,李明并没有满足于此。他深知,人工智能领域的发展日新月异,只有不断优化和创新,才能保持竞争力。
为了进一步提升小智的性能,李明开始研究新的技术,如深度学习、自然语言处理等。他希望通过这些技术,进一步提升小智的智能水平,使其能够更好地为用户提供服务。
在李明的努力下,小智逐渐成为了一款深受用户喜爱的智能助手。然而,他并没有停下脚步。他深知,在人工智能领域,只有不断追求卓越,才能在激烈的竞争中脱颖而出。
如今,李明已经成为了一名优秀的AI助手开发者,他的作品也得到了业界的认可。他坚信,在不久的将来,人工智能技术将更加成熟,为我们的生活带来更多便利。而他,也将继续为这个美好的未来努力奋斗。
猜你喜欢:AI实时语音